The Iconic Captain Cook Monument: While anchored in the heart of the bay, you will enjoy a stunning, up-close view of the Captain Cook Monument. This striking white obelisk stands as a historic landmark marking the spot where Captain James Cook first landed in the Hawaiian Islands in 1779. It adds a touch of rich, fascinating local history to your tropical getaway.

FYI: Kealakekua Bay is notoriously difficult to access by land—hiking down the steep cliffs takes hours and requires a strenuous permit. Booking a boat tour is the safest, most comfortable, and most rewarding way to experience the bay!
